Abstract

Theft according to Decision Number: 719/Pid.B/2023/PN. The incident, in which the perpetrator was the victim's domestic assistant (hereinafter abbreviated as ART), began on Friday, June 16, 2023, when the witness Desi Laurina took the witness's child to therapy in Solo for 20 days normative legal norm method of legal research, namely the review of the results of an investigation into the criminal liability of a domestic servant who commits the crime of theft, through a review of various literature, not limited in time and place, as well as a review of various literature in the form of books in the employer's house Duplicating room keys based on Decision No. 719 /Pid.B/2023/PN Tjk. Acts committed by the accused shall be punished with a prison sentence of 2 months and 20 days, as determined by the panel of judges of the Tanjungkarang District Court Class 1 A on September 18, 2023. And the judge's considerations when deciding on this perpetrator of the crime of theft in the employer's house by duplicating the room key on the basis of Decision No. 719/Pid.B/2023/PN Tjk. It is unreasonable and does not comply with the provisions of current laws and regulations, and the author believes that the jury's verdict is too lenient for the perpetrator who committed the crime of theft, causing public unrest and the employer causes harm to the defendant, so that no deterrent effect can be achieved for the perpetrator. Suggestions for law enforcement officers to take appropriate measures regarding the crime of theft and provide strict legal sanctions because the theft committed by the accused is very harmful to other people and disturbs the community. However, the sentence imposed is only two months in prison
